Wrong.

The website, through its shipping partner already calculates what duties/customs will be and have that amount added to your order total. When you receive the package, no one will ask you to pay extra for these things. It's already been taken care of. Now, if the actual duty fees come out to be more than what you were charged on the website, that is their loss.

Here's an example..Back when SDCC was happening, I ordered my FoC Bruticus giftset from Hasbro Toy Shop. They also use that system of having you pay the duty fees ahead of time. When FedEx delivered my package, they didn't ask for anything. HOWEVER, a week after, I get a letter from FedEX telling me I owe something like $16 for duty fees. I was like 'fuck no.' So I called HTS and explained myself and I was told that I did not have to pay that fee, that they would contact FedEx and deal with them. The next day I received an email from HTS telling me everything was taken care of and indeed, I never heard back from FedEx.
